Saudi Arabia Issues Early Warning in Western Province Amid Unconfirmed Reports of Explosions

According to the International Desk of Webangah News Agency, Saudi Arabia has issued an early warning in its western province. The Saudi Red Crescent Authority announced that a danger alert was issued in the Yanbu province, located in the west of the country, through the “National Early Warning System.” Specific details regarding the nature of the threat or the reason for the alert have not been provided in the official announcement.
However, unofficial sources have reported hearing the sound of powerful explosions in Yanbu, Saudi Arabia. Further unconfirmed reports suggest that Yemen launched significant missile and drone attacks against Saudi Arabia. Some sources also claim that more than five explosions have shaken the city of Jizan, which is located on the border with Yemen. Additionally, unofficial news indicates that the industrial area in Jizan was targeted by Yemeni forces, resulting in a power outage in several districts of the city.
